Delaware LLC Formation – Dive Into Expert Understanding

Forming a Delaware LLC is not just a simple process; it’s a game-changer for your business. From unparalleled legal protections to tax advantages, the perks are substantial.

But before you dive into the intricacies of Delaware LLC formation, there are crucial factors to consider. Understanding the legal requirements, the steps involved, and the business-friendly laws of Delaware is essential to making informed decisions for your company’s future.

As you navigate through the complexities of forming a Delaware LLC, you’ll need to be equipped with the knowledge and insights to ensure that your business is set up for success.

Key Takeaways

  • Delaware LLC formation offers tax advantages by not imposing taxes on intangible assets or shares of stock for Delaware corporations.
  • Forming an LLC in Delaware provides liability protection, shielding personal assets from business debts and legal liabilities.
  • Delaware’s business-friendly laws and favorable environment make it an attractive choice for entrepreneurs and businesses.
  • Delaware’s well-established corporate law provides flexibility, predictability, and privacy protections for LLC owners.

Benefits of Forming a Delaware LLC

Why should you consider forming a Delaware LLC?

There are several compelling reasons, including tax advantages and liability protection. Delaware is known for its business-friendly laws and tax advantages, making it an attractive choice for entrepreneurs and businesses.

One of the key benefits of forming an LLC in Delaware is the tax advantages it offers. Delaware doesn’t impose taxes on intangible assets or shares of stock for Delaware corporations, making it an appealing option for many businesses.

Additionally, Delaware offers strong liability protection for LLC members. By forming an LLC in Delaware, you can shield your personal assets from business debts and legal liabilities, providing a layer of security and peace of mind. This means that in the event of a lawsuit or financial difficulties, your personal assets such as your home, car, or savings are generally protected.

These benefits make Delaware an ideal location for establishing an LLC, offering a favorable environment for businesses to thrive while minimizing tax burdens and protecting personal assets.

Legal Requirements for Delaware LLC Formation

To form a Delaware LLC, you must adhere to specific legal requirements outlined by the state. Ensuring compliance with the legal guidelines is crucial for the successful formation of your LLC. Below is a table summarizing the key legal requirements for forming a Delaware LLC:

Legal Requirement Description Importance
Name Selection Choose a unique and distinguishable LLC name. Ensures your LLC name is not already in use.
Registered Agent Appoint a registered agent with a physical address. Ensures you have a reliable point of contact.
Certificate of Formation File the necessary forms with the Delaware Division of Corporations. Officially establishes your LLC as a legal entity.

Adhering to these legal requirements not only ensures the smooth formation of your Delaware LLC but also provides a solid legal foundation for your business. It’s essential to carefully follow these guidelines to avoid any potential legal issues in the future.

Steps to Forming a Delaware LLC

After ensuring compliance with the legal requirements for forming a Delaware LLC, you can proceed with the steps to establish your LLC in the state.

The first step is to complete the LLC registration process. This involves filing a Certificate of Formation with the Delaware Division of Corporations and paying the required filing fee. Once your LLC is registered, it’s important to draft an operating agreement. This document outlines the ownership and operating procedures of your LLC, helping to avoid potential disputes among members.

Understanding the tax implications of your Delaware LLC is crucial. Delaware offers favorable tax treatment for LLCs, including no sales tax and no tax on intangible assets. However, it’s important to consult with a tax professional to ensure compliance with federal and state tax laws.

Additionally, forming a Delaware LLC provides liability protection for its members. The LLC structure helps to separate personal assets from business liabilities, shielding members from being personally responsible for the debts and obligations of the business.

Understanding Delaware’s Business-Friendly Laws

Delaware’s business-friendly laws create an advantageous environment for entrepreneurs and businesses seeking to establish a strong legal foundation. Understanding Delaware’s business-friendly laws is essential for anyone considering forming an LLC in the state.

Here are a few key points to help you grasp the business advantages and legal implications of Delaware’s laws:

  • Flexibility: Delaware offers a high degree of flexibility in structuring and operating an LLC. The state’s laws allow for extensive freedom to customize the internal affairs of the company, providing a favorable environment for businesses to operate in a manner that suits their specific needs.

  • Predictability: Delaware’s well-established and extensive body of corporate law provides predictability and stability for businesses. The state’s Court of Chancery, which specializes in corporate law, offers consistent and reliable decisions, reducing uncertainty and potential legal disputes for businesses.

  • Privacy Protections: Delaware offers privacy protections for business owners. The state allows for confidential filings, protecting the identities of LLC members and managers, which can be advantageous for individuals seeking to maintain a level of anonymity in their business operations.

Understanding these aspects of Delaware’s business-friendly laws can help you make informed decisions when forming an LLC in the state.

Considerations for Delaware LLC Owners

Considering Delaware’s business-friendly laws, LLC owners should be aware of key considerations that can impact their operations and legal obligations in the state.

When it comes to tax implications, Delaware offers attractive tax benefits for LLCs. The state doesn’t impose sales tax, and there’s no state corporate income tax on profits earned outside of Delaware. This can result in substantial tax savings for your LLC. However, it’s important to consult with a tax professional to fully understand the tax implications for your specific business activities.

Another crucial consideration for Delaware LLC owners is liability protection. Delaware is known for its strong legal precedent and well-established case law that offers robust liability protection for LLC owners. By forming your LLC in Delaware, you can shield your personal assets from any potential lawsuits or debts incurred by the business. This protection can provide peace of mind and enhance the overall security of your business operations.

Frequently Asked Questions

Can a Delaware LLC Be Formed by a Non-Resident or Non-Us Citizen?

Yes, a Delaware LLC can be formed by a non-resident or non-US citizen. You can initiate the formation process by appointing a registered agent and filing the necessary documentation with the Delaware Division of Corporations.

Is It Possible to Convert an Existing Business Entity Into a Delaware Llc?

Yes, you can convert an existing business entity into a Delaware LLC. The process involves filing a certificate of conversion with the Delaware Secretary of State. It’s essential to consider the legal implications before proceeding.

What Are the Annual Maintenance Requirements for a Delaware Llc?

To maintain your Delaware LLC, you must meet annual reporting and compliance requirements. Filing an annual report and paying the franchise tax are necessary. Ensure you stay up to date with these obligations.

Are There Any Restrictions on the Types of Businesses That Can Form a Delaware Llc?

Yes, there are restrictions on the types of businesses that can form a Delaware LLC. Certain professional services like legal or medical practices may have additional formation process requirements.

How Does Delaware LLC Formation Affect Taxes for the Business and Its Owners?

When forming a Delaware LLC, tax implications depend on the ownership structure. As a member, you’ll likely pay taxes on your share of the LLC’s profits, while the LLC itself may be subject to franchise taxes.

Conclusion

So, now you know the benefits of forming a Delaware LLC, the legal requirements, and the steps to take to get started.

Understanding Delaware’s business-friendly laws and considering the implications for owners are key to successfully forming and operating a Delaware LLC.

With this knowledge, you’re ready to take the next steps in forming your own Delaware LLC and reaping the benefits of doing business in the First State.

Good luck!

Leave a Reply

Your email address will not be published. Required fields are marked *